Issa Hayatou, a Cameroonian sports executive and former athlete, is renowned for his influential roles in football administration. He held the presidency of the Confederation of African Football (CAF) for nearly three decades, playing a key role in advancing African football. Additionally, he temporarily assumed the position of FIFA president in the aftermath of a corruption scandal. Despite previous bribery accusations, Hayatou continued to hold significant positions in international sports governance, including serving as a member of the International Olympic Committee.
